Lyney is a strong, self-sufficient Pyro main DPS who both deals damage and heals himself, so your team stays flexible. A 4pc Marechaussee Hunter is all he needs to shine, no signature bow required. Push his CRIT Rate toward 80% so you don't whiff crits in his short damage windows, and keep a healer around since he burns his own HP. If you like mono Pyro, Bennett plus Xiangling already carries him far.

Charged Attack
Performs a more precise Aimed Shot with increased DMG.
While aiming, flames will run across the arrowhead before being fired. Different effects will occur based on the time spent charging.
·Charge Level 1: Fires off a Pyro-infused arrow, dealing Pyro DMG.
·Charge Level 2: Fires off a Prop Arrow that deals Pyro DMG, and upon hit, it will summon a Grin-Malkin Hat.
When firing the Prop Arrow, and when Lyney has more than 60% HP, he will consume a portion of his HP to obtain 1 Prop Surplus stack. Max 5 stacks. The effect will be removed after the character spends 30s out of combat.
The lowest Lyney can drop to through this method is 60% of his Max HP.
Grin-Malkin Hat
·Can taunt nearby opponents and attract their attacks. Each opponent can only be taunted by the Hat once every 5s.
·The Hat will inherit a percentage of Lyney's Max HP.
·If destroyed, or if its duration expires, it will fire off a Pyrotechnic Strike at 1 nearby opponent, dealing Pyro DMG.
Only 1 Hat can exist at any given time.
Arkhe: Pneuma
At certain intervals, the Prop Arrow will cause a Spiritbreath Thorn to descend upon its hit location, dealing Pneuma-aligned Pyro DMG.
Bewildering Lights
When used, he will clear all current Prop Surplus stacks and deal AoE Pyro DMG to opponents in front of him. DMG will be increased according to the stacks cleared, and this will also regenerate Lyney's HP based on his Max HP.
When a Grin-Malkin Hat created by Lyney is on the field, the fireworks will cause it to explode, dealing AoE Pyro DMG equal to that of a Pyrotechnic Strike.
The DMG dealt through the Grin-Malkin Hat in this way is considered Charged Attack DMG.

Combat Rotation
- Open with Elemental Skill (E) "Wondrous Trick: Miracle Parade" — Lyney turns into a Grin-Malkin Cat that automatically deals AoE Pyro damage to nearby foes.
- When the E's duration ends, Lyney reappears and sets off fireworks for AoE Pyro damage, summons a Grin-Malkin Hat, and gains 1 Prop Surplus stack.
- Fire a Charged (Aimed) Shot that consumes HP to trigger the "Perilous Performance" passive — it restores 3 Energy and adds 80% of ATK as bonus DMG whenever it hits the Grin-Malkin Hat, while also building extra Prop Surplus stacks.
- Repeat the HP-consuming Charged Shots a few times to both reach the 60 Energy needed for his Burst and stack Prop Surplus up to its 5-stack cap.
- Once you have 60 Energy and max stacks, unleash Elemental Burst (Q) "Bewildering Lights" to clear all Prop Surplus stacks, dealing AoE Pyro damage that scales with stacks cleared and healing Lyney based on his Max HP.
- If a Grin-Malkin Hat is still on the field, the Burst's firework will detonate it too, dealing one more instance of AoE Pyro damage equal to a Charged Attack.
- Make use of the "Conclusive Ovation" passive: DMG dealt to Pyro-affected enemies is boosted by 60%, plus another 20% per additional Pyro teammate (up to 100% total).
- Wait out the Skill's 15s cooldown, then repeat the E → HP-consuming Charged Shots → Q loop to keep the DPS cycle going.

Bewildering Lights
| Lv 1 | Lv 10 | Lv 13 |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Skill DMG | 167.2% | 301.0% | 355.3% |
| Skill DMG Bonus | 53.2% ATK/Stack | 95.8% ATK/Stack | 113.1% ATK/Stack |
| HP Regeneration | 20%/Stack | 20%/Stack | 20%/Stack |
| CD | 15.0s | 15.0s | 15.0s |
Wondrous Trick: Miracle Parade
| Lv 1 | Lv 10 | Lv 13 |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Skill DMG | 154.0% | 277.2% | 327.3% |
| Explosive Firework DMG | 414.0% | 745.2% | 879.8% |
| Duration | 3.0s | 3.0s | 3.0s |
| CD | 15.0s | 15.0s | 15.0s |
| Energy Cost | 60 | 60 | 60 |
